A JOINT STATEMENT BY THE NATIONAL ASSOCIATION OF NIGERIAN STUDENTS (NANS) JCC OSUN AXIS IN CONJUNCTION WITH THE ZONE D GENERAL SECRETARY AND NAUS CMC OSUN AXIS
DEMOCRACY DAY REFLECTION: A CALL TO ACTION FOR OSUN STATE GOVERNMENT
_12/06/2025_
As we commemorate Democracy Day, we, the leadership of NANS JCC Osun Axis, in collaboration with other student stakeholders, express our profound disappointment and disillusionment with the Osun State government's failure to uphold the promises of June 12 and honor the legacy of MKO Abiola.
The ideals of democracy, which include freedom, justice, and equality, seem to be mere rhetoric in our state.
The recent increase in tuition fees across all institutions in Osun State, without any corresponding measures to support students, is a stark reminder of the disconnect between the government and the student community. Students who dare to express their grievances are met with suspensions, expulsions, and intimidation. This is not the democracy we were promised.
We demand that the Osun State government takes immediate action to address the following pressing issues:
1. Immediate reduction of tuition fees:
The astronomical increase of tuition is exorbitant and unsustainable for many students. We request a substantial reduction to make education accessible to all.
2. Recognition of student bodies: We demand that student organizations be recognized and involved in shaping the educational system and addressing the challenges faced by students.
3. Regularization of student grants and bursaries: Students deserve timely and adequate financial support to enable them to focus on their academic pursuits.
4. Provision of optimum security: Students should feel safe in their academic environments, free from fear of intimidation, harassment, or violence.
5. Reorientation of management bodies: We call for seminars and workshops to sensitize management bodies on the importance of respecting students' rights and freedoms.
We, the over 250,000 Nigerian students in Osun State, stand united in our demand for a better educational system. We say,
"Dare to struggle, dare to win!"
We will not be silenced or intimidated. We will continue to agitate for our rights and demand accountability from our government.
